Far-infrared absorption in single-electron transistors: Theoretical results and experiment proposal

Mesoscale and Nanoscale Physics 2010-05-12 v2 Strongly Correlated Electrons

Abstract

We present theoretical results on far-infrared (FIR) absorption of single-electron transistors. Based on them, we propose and explain how to conduct combined FIR--dc-transport experiments to determine the charging energy and other relevant parameters, without measuring FIR intensities.
